Carter Bankshares, Inc. Common Stock (CARE)

Carter Bankshares, Inc. (CARE) is a community-focused financial holding company that provides a range of banking services through its subsidiary, Carter Bank & Trust. The bank offers personal and business banking solutions, including loans, deposits, and wealth management services, primarily serving communities in Virginia and North Carolina. Founded in 1972, Carter Bankshares emphasizes local decision-making and community involvement.
